Nie dziwię się Mirki, że jest taka popularność szkoleń wszelkiej maści i bootcampów, gdzie za możliwość nauki i opanowania nowoczesnych technologii i frameworków musicie zapłacić. Nie dziwię się również że samodzielna nauka, gdzie wydaje Wam się że możecie to opanować nie wydając za to złamanego grosza to droga przez mękę. Znalazłem w miarę reprezentatywny przykład bloga opartego na ReactJS

https://github.com/gothinkster/react-redux-realworld-example-app

Korzysta z jakiegoś API w oparciu o tokenową autoryzację, rejestrację i logowanie. Fajnie że
  • 8
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

Co to dużo pisać... takie jest życie... życie programisty. Trzeba się cały czas uczyć. Dziś framework jest, jutro go nie ma, dziś się pisze w JS, jutro w czymś innym. A co do samodzielnej nauki to podstawa. Bez podejścia do samodzielnej nauki i poszerzania horyzontów nie ma co się pchać w to.

Ale z drugiej strony jak się nabierze doświadczenia, to zmiana frameworku, bibiolteki czy języka programowania to jak zmiana butów. Jak
  • Odpowiedz
@daro1: To błąd logiczny, oszukujemy się, że jeżeli za coś zapłacimy, to przyniesie to określony rezultat. Ta wiedza powinna sama nam wpływać do głowy, bo przecież zapłaciliśmy. Programowanie jest ogólnie bardzo przystępną nauką, bo zakres informacji pisanej jest przeogromny. Dodajmy do tego społeczność, która zawsze służy pomocą (nawet tym, którzy mają problem z „Hello Word’em”), filmiki, aplikacje, meetupy, podkasty i mamy szeroki wachlarz możliwości - ZA DARMO. Później możemy wziąć
  • Odpowiedz
polecicie jakieś firmy / osoby do pocięcia front endu, 1 strona landing page (+tablet / mobile), dostarczam PSD z widokami ewentualnie wrzucam na zeplina itp klienci ciągle pytają i po prostu potrzebuję mieć kilka opcji, dla takich z pieniędzmy i dla takich bez dużego budżetu #html #frontend #kiciochpyta
  • 1
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

Cześć Mirki,
mam problem z wysyłaniem danych POSTem,a raczej z jego kodowaniem.
Nie potrafię osiągnąć takiego samego wyniku dla formularza klasycznie wysyłanego z www ( =>submit) i wysyłanego przez JS (fetch/axios/XMLHttpRequest)
Przykładowo dla ciągu znaków: ąĄćĆęĘłŁóÓżŻźŹ
Wysyłając 'klasycznie' dostaje: %B9%A5%E6%C6%EA%CA%B3%A3%F3%D3%BF%AF%9F%8F
Wysyłając fetch/axios/XMLHttpRequest: %C4%85%C4%84%C4%87%C4%86%C4%99%C4%98%C5%82%C5%81%C3%B3%C3%93%C5%BC%C5%BB%C5%BA%C5%B9
  • 10
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

@fusen:
var myHeaders = new Headers();
myHeaders.append("Content-Type", "application/x-www-form-urlencoded;charset=windows-1250");

var urlencoded = new URLSearchParams();
  • Odpowiedz
via Wykop Mobilny (Android)
  • 1
jako że chwilowo naszło mnie znów na zagłębienie się bardziej we frontend to mam pytanie związane trochę z wyborem języka pod Svelte. Svelte na razie nie ma supportu dla czegokolwiek innego niż JavaScript (i chyba tak zostanie przez jakiś czas, może na stałe).

i to byłoby całkiem ok, gdyby nie moja niechęć do czystego #javascript. nie chodzi nawet o to że jest nieco bałaganiarski. najbardziej brakuje mi w nim obsługi
  • 8
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

via Wykop Mobilny (Android)
  • 1
koleżanki i koledzy (wstęp jak z zebrania partyjnego :-) mam pytanie do wszystkich siedzących nieco dłużej w #programowanie #frontend

jakie frameworki, podejścia, biblioteki do UI (niepopularne jeszcze) uważacie za przyszłościowe?

(wiem że to trochę spekulacja, więc proszę o krótkie wytłumaczenie dlaczego jakieś podejście uważacie za sensowne, ciekawe, co je wyróżnia itp)

wiadomo
  • 10
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

@secret_passenger: Raczej React, Angular i Vue zostanie na bardzo długo, tym bardziej że wiele apek zostało w nich napisanych i są to frameworki, które żyją, mają się dobrze i się rozwijają. Do .NET doszło takie coś jak Blazor i być może warto chociaż rzucić na to okiem, ale nie wiem jak z popularnością tego rozwiązania na rynku. Projekt pisz w znanych technologiach, bo jak znasz popularną technologię to szybciej znajdziesz
  • Odpowiedz
@secret_passenger: Aktualnie zainteresowałem się tailwind.css i muszę przyznać że ciekawe rozwiązanie, utility first. Z minusów to robi się trochę dużo klas w HTML i jest mało czytelny.
  • Odpowiedz
około 6 miesięcy na front wcześniej byłem w technikum informatycznym, które w tym konktekście nic nie dało
później przez prawie 2 lata jakieś randomowe prace
po 6 miesiącach nauki załapałem 1wsza pracę
  • Odpowiedz
Jak to wygląda w #frontend z frameworkami? Robicie tylko stronki, czy też aplikacje? Bo zauważyłem, że niektóre firmy zajmują się tylko samymi aplikacjami? Czym się różni budowa aplikacji natywnej od aplikacji webowej (stronki)?
  • 3
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

@doee: może mu chodzić też o aplikacje natywne na Windowsa/Maca

Ale fakt, to co robię w pracy nazwałbym raczej aplikacjami, dla zwykłych stron, wizytówek firm frameworków nie ma za bardzo po co zaprzęgać
  • Odpowiedz
@bonaventure: Nie ma wielkiej różnicy w samym developmencie, chociaż React Native to nie to samo co React. API i zasada działania jest taka sama, ale musisz używać predefiniowanych komponentów z React Native, nie używasz w JSX elementów HTML. Dodatkowo różni się stylowanie, tam nie ma CSS. No i proces deploymentu jest całkiem inny. To chyba najciężej ogarnąć, bo ma trafiać do App Store/Google Store. Reszta jest bez tragedii, łatwo wskoczyć
  • Odpowiedz
Zapraszamy do lektury najnowszego wydania Prasówki Technologicznej. Tym razem frontendowcy będą mogli stawić czoła niektórym problemom, które pojawiają się, gdy przesiadamy się z tworzenia stron typu server-rendered do client-rendered, a backendowcy dowiedzą się, jak ogarnia się na produkcji platformę zarządzającą ponad 3,5 milionami uczniów (1500 baz danych i 65 tys. requestów na sekundę w peaku). Sprawdzimy też, dlaczego Korea Południowa zamierza przejść na Linuksa.

-> Zapisz się na mirkolistę: https://mirkolisty.pvu.pl/list/kqLmWfjCV96YaWzk
-> AlertTag:
justjoinit - Zapraszamy do lektury najnowszego wydania Prasówki Technologicznej. Tym ...

źródło: comment_15822826506hmhOq3t0JtoGYsPbpGmZh.jpg

Pobierz
  • 5
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

Po pierwsze zmokuj se API albo korzystaj z jakiś open API.
Po drugie jak w ogóle nie chcesz bawić się w "internety" zrób jakiegoś toola, który korzysta z urządzeń użytkownika. Stroik gitarowy przez mikrofon?
Wirtualne pianino przez API Midi.

Serio, nie samym internetem człowiek żyje xD Dzisiejsze "webapki" wcale nie muszą być takie web.
https://studio.psdetch.com/ - ubogi "fotoszop", którego używam do cięcia layoutów bo jest lżejszy od prawdziwego PSa.
  • Odpowiedz